#3e0a58 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3e0a58 is composed of 24.3% red, 3.9%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.5% cyan, 88.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 65.5% black. It has a hue angle of 280 degrees, a saturation of 79.6% and a lightness of 19.2%. #3e0a58 color hex could be obtained by blending #7c14b0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

● #3e0a58 color description : Very dark violet.
#3e0a58 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3e0a58 has RGB values of R:62, G:10, B:88 and CMYK values of C:0.3, M:0.89, Y:0, K:0.65. Its decimal value is 4065880.

Shades and Tints of #3e0a58
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0212 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#3e0a58
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#313032 is the less saturated color, while #410260 is the most saturated one.
